Live calls put the entire burden on gate agents - remembering correct phrasing, required compliance elements, proper pronunciation of destinations, all while managing impatient passengers. Predefined announcements eliminate this pressure. Gate agents select the appropriate announcement from organized categories matching the boarding stage, press play, and TTS-generated audio delivers consistent messaging. Agents stay focused on passengers instead of scripting announcements in their head. When situations require personal communication, live paging remains available through the same interface.

GateUI is a web-based touch interface designed specifically for gate agents. It displays only flights assigned to their gate and organizes ready-made announcements by boarding stage - pre-boarding, group calls, final calls. Agents select the announcement category, choose the specific message, and press play. No typing, no complex inputs, no remembering scripts. The interface works on workstation computers, tablets, or nnounce micnode2 touchscreen stations with built-in microphones for live calls when needed.

When gate agents don't need to compose and deliver live announcements for every boarding stage, they spend that time helping passengers. Predefined announcements handle routine communication - boarding groups, final calls, delay notifications - with one touch. Agents focus on solving individual traveler problems, answering questions, and managing the gate area. Faster workflows mean better gate turnaround times without adding headcount. Legislative measures often require specific information in specific formats - accessibility compliance, safety messaging, language requirements. Expecting airport agents to remember and correctly deliver all required elements during live announcements is unrealistic, especially during stressful boarding situations with impatient passengers. Airport CX uses predefined announcement templates that support correct content every time. We configure compliant templates once; operators simply select and activate them. No memorization, no missed elements, no compliance gaps under pressure. Yes. Airport CX supports airline-specific announcement templates that reflect each carrier's branding, special requirements, and preferred messaging. Gate agents see the relevant airline's announcements when working their assigned flights. Some airlines provide professional voice recordings; others use custom TTS configurations matching their brand voice. The system organizes everything so agents select from the right announcement set without manually tracking which airline requires what messaging.

Both options exist. The core value of Airport CX comes from predefined templates and intuitive interfaces that work regardless of your data infrastructure. For airports with reliable, real-time AODB integration, announcements can trigger automatically when flight status changes - boarding status triggers boarding calls, delays trigger delay announcements. But many airports prefer agent-activated workflows where the interface presents the right announcements at the right time and agents confirm with one touch. You control which approach fits your operations and data quality.
